Rough Plumbing Installation in Denver, CO
Rough plumbing installation services involve setting up the primary water supply and waste lines within a property, typically during new construction or major renovations. This service covers tasks such as installing main water lines, drain pipes, vent stacks, and other essential plumbing components needed to support sinks, toilets, bathtubs, and appliances. Property owners often seek this service when building a new home, adding an extension, or upgrading existing plumbing infrastructure to ensure a reliable and functional plumbing system.
Before requesting rough plumbing installation, homeowners should consider the scope of their project, including the size of the property and the number of plumbing fixtures planned. It’s also important to understand the layout of the property, including where water sources and waste outlets will be positioned, to facilitate proper pipe routing. Clear communication about project plans and any specific plumbing requirements can help ensure the installation aligns with the property’s needs and future usage.

Rough Plumbing Installation Questions
What is rough plumbing installation? It involves installing the main water supply and drain lines before finishing the walls and floors of a property.
When is rough plumbing typically done? It is usually performed during the initial construction or major renovation stages before wall coverings are installed.
What types of projects require rough plumbing installation? New construction, bathroom or kitchen remodels, and additions often need rough plumbing work to set up water and waste lines.
What should property owners consider before starting rough plumbing? Ensuring proper planning for fixture placement and understanding local building codes can help streamline the installation process.
